This nice cream has got the sweetness from the bananas, the spice from the vanilla and cinnamon, the superfood goodness from the maca, the salt to balance the sweet and the crunch from the toppings. It’s a serious game changer when it comes to sugar swaps. It’s dairy free too, so for anyone avoiding dairy, we’ve got your ice cream fix covered!
Serves 2
Ingredients
3 frozen ripe bananas
1 tsp of vanilla powder
1 tablespoon of cashew butter
1 teaspoon of maca powder
½ teaspoon of cinnamon
¼ teaspoon of pink himalayan salt
½ tsp honey or maple syrup (optional)
Toppings
Handful of shelled pistachios
1 teaspoon of bee pollen
1 teaspoon of cashew butter
Dash of cinnamon
Method
Start by peeling your ripe bananas, chopping into quarters and then freezing overnight. Make sure you’re using really ripe bananas, as these are the sweetest!
Once frozen, remove from the freezer and leave to soften for about 5 minutes. Then add to your food processor and blitz (unless you have a high quality blender like a Vitamix, it’s best to make this in a food processor).
Process the bananas for a minute so they start to break down. Scrape down the sides and add in the remaining ingredients, then process again. This will take a few minutes until the bananas have completely broken down. Eventually it should form a thick, smooth and creamy consistency.
Then transfer into your bowl and top with the shelled pistachios, cashew butter, cinnamon and bee pollen. I love topping it with something crunchy like nuts to get a real contrast in textures.
